Google launches four new features for Android TV

Developers from Google have announced four new features that will soon become available to owners of TVs running the Android TV operating system. This week in India there were submitted Motorola smart TVs running Android TV. New features for the Android TV operating system will initially be available to users in India, and will later appear in other countries.

Google has unveiled four new features to help users get the most out of their smart TVs, even when internet connectivity is limited or inconsistent.

The first function, called Data Saver, will help to significantly reduce the amount of traffic consumed when connecting to the Internet via a mobile connection. According to available data, this approach will increase viewing time by 3 times. The Data Alerts tool is provided to control the data used while watching TV. The feature will be launched in India first, as wired internet in the country is not very good and many people have to use the mobile network.

A tool called Hotspot Guide will help you set up your TV using a mobile hotspot. The Cast in Files feature allows you to view media files downloaded to your smartphone directly on your TV without using up mobile data. All new features will be rolled out to Android TV devices in India soon, after which they will be rolled out globally.
